Chris is looking at a map with the scale 1 inch: 5 miles. The length of Partridge Creek Road on the map is 4 inches. How long is

the actual road?
Mathematics
1 answer:
Mrac [35]2 years ago
6 0

The scale is 1 inch = 5 miles.

Multiply total inches by 5 miles:


4 x 5 = 20


Answer: 20 miles

Using it's concept, it is found that there is a \frac{13}{102} probability that the first card is a club and the second one is black.

<h3>What is a probability?</h3>

A probability is given by the <u>number of desired outcomes divided by the number of total outcomes</u>.

In this problem:

  • In a deck, there are 52 cards, of which 13 are clubs, hence P(A) = \frac{13}{52} = \frac{1}{4}.
  • Then, of the remaining 51 cards, 26 are black, hence P(B) = \frac{26}{51}.

Then:

p = P(A)P(B) = \frac{1}{4} \times \frac{26}{51} = \frac{13}{102}

\frac{13}{102} probability that the first card is a club and the second one is black.
